সিস্টেম ঘড়ি সঠিকভাবে সেটআপ করা হয় না


1

আমার লিনাক্স সিস্টেমের TinyCore, কার্নেল 2.6.38 সিস্টেমে ঘড়ির সাথে আমার অদ্ভুত সমস্যা রয়েছে।
ডমেসগ নিম্নলিখিত বলে:

rtc_cmos 00:04: setting system clock to 2012-08-08 19:20:00 UTC (since_epoch-value)

কিন্তু আসলে, যখন আমি পরীক্ষা করি date, এটি সবসময় 1/1/2001 01:43:00 হিসাবে শুরু হয়, যখন hwclock সঠিক সময় দেখায়।
এখন যদি আমি চালানো hwclock -s, এটা পরবর্তী বুট পর্যন্ত সংশোধন করা হয়।
এই সিস্টেমটি একটি "লাইভ সিডি" যা RAM তে লোড করা হয় এবং স্টোরেজ ডিভাইসটিকে umount করে।
আমার অনুমান হল যে কার্নেলটি প্রকৃতপক্ষে rtc0 থেকে সময় নির্ধারণ করেছেন, কিন্তু সম্ভবত একটি ফাইল ওভাররাইটিং সিস্টেম ঘড়ি পুনরায় সেট করে। এটা হতে পারে (অন্তর্ভুক্ত / dev / কিছু)?


আমি একটি সমাধান দিয়ে উত্তর দিয়েছি, কিন্তু এর সাথে আপনি কি বোঝাতে চান: "সিস্টেম একটি লাইভ সিডি মত হয়" ?
Zuul

আমি যে সিস্টেমে কোন অ-উদ্বায়ী স্টোরেজ মানে। তাই প্রতিটি বুট, একই ফাইল সিস্টেম লোড করা হয়।
RoeeK

উত্তর:


0

পটভূমি

লিনাক্সে, সিস্টেমের সময় অঞ্চলটি সিম্বলিক লিঙ্ক দ্বারা নির্ধারিত হয় /etc/localtime

এই উল্লিখিত লিঙ্কটি একটি সময় অঞ্চল তথ্য ফাইল যা স্থানীয় সময় অঞ্চল বর্ণনা করে। সময় অঞ্চল তথ্য ফাইল হয় এ অবস্থিত হয় /usr/lib/zoneinfo অথবা /usr/share/zoneinfo আপনি যে লিনাক্সের ব্যবহার করেন তার উপর নির্ভর করে।

hwclock

হার্ডওয়্যার ক্লক অ্যাক্সেসের জন্য hwclock একটি সরঞ্জাম। আপনি বর্তমান সময় প্রদর্শন করতে পারেন, নির্দিষ্ট সময়ের জন্য হার্ডওয়্যার ক্লক সেট করতে, সিস্টেমের সময় হার্ডওয়্যার ক্লক সেট করতে পারেন এবং সিস্টেমের সময় হার্ডওয়্যার ক্লক থেকে সেট করতে পারেন।

হার্ডওয়্যার ক্লক: এটি এমন একটি ঘড়ি যা সিপিএলে চলমান কোনও নিয়ন্ত্রণ প্রোগ্রামের স্বাধীনভাবে সঞ্চালিত হয় এবং এমনকি যখন মেশিনটি চালিত হয়।

আপনি ব্যবহার করেন -s এটি হার্ডওয়্যার ক্লক থেকে সিস্টেম টাইম সেট করবে। যে কেন আপনি সমস্যা সংশোধন পেতে।

সমাধান

আপনি সিম্বলিক লিঙ্কটি সেট করতে আপনার টার্মিনালে একটি কমান্ড চালাতে পারেন, এটি পুনরায় বুট করার পরেও চলতে থাকবে:

sudo ln -sf /usr/share/zoneinfo/Portugal /etc/localtime

আমার পর্তুগালের জন্য, আপনার সময় অঞ্চলে কমান্ডটি মানানসই করুন।


বিনিময় TinyCore হয়, এবং আমার / usr / lib / zoneinfo এবং / usr / share / zoneinfo এবং / etc / স্থানীয় সময় নেই। এটি বুট থেকে আপডেট করা হয় না এমন এই সমস্যাটি সৃষ্টি করতে পারে, কিন্তু যখন আমি সঠিকভাবে আপডেট হয় hwclock -s ম্যানুয়ালি?
RoeeK
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.